Introduction And Rondo Capriccioso, Op. 28 - Piano / Violin (Violin and Piano). By Camille Saint-Saens (1835-1921). Edited by Henri Schradieck. Arranged by Henry Schradieck. For violin and piano (Violin). String Solo. Classical Period. Difficulty: medium. Set of performance parts (includes separate pull out violin part). Solo part and piano accompaniment. 20 pages. G. Schirmer #LB224. Published by G. Schirmer (HL.50253560).
ISBN 1458494438. With solo part and piano accompaniment. Classical Period. 9x12 inches.
